Tune Out the Noise

To hear your own music, you must first lower the volume of the outside world. This requires conscious effort. It means setting boundaries with negative influences and curating your information diet. Furthermore, it involves practicing mindfulness to distinguish your own thoughts from societal programming. Take time for quiet reflection. Journaling, meditation, or long walks can help you reconnect with your inner voice. Ultimately, the more you listen to yourself, the clearer your personal song becomes. This clarity provides the confidence to dance to your own beat, regardless of who is watching.
